The invention relates to a plastic wine bottle which has an indentation in the bottom of the bottle of such dimensions that, when a plurality of wine bottles are placed or stacked one on top of the other, the bottle neck of the respective lower wine bottle can be inserted into the indentation in the bottom of the next wine bottle above it. As a result - in contrast to previously conventional embodiments of wine bottles - a plurality of bottles can be safely stacked on top of one another on one shelf, without intermediate shelves being necessary. The wine bottle is of substantially cuboid design, the four lateral walls having an outward curvature. In a preferred embodiment, the transition zones between adjacent lateral walls are of angled design. This produces a substantial reduction of the space requirement, both for storage in a selling outlet, where the bottles stand upright so that their labels are legible, and also during transport, when a plurality of bottles are to be packed in one carton.
